Just how cheap do music downloads need to be before listeners will buy them rather than pull ‘em from P2P? About three cents, reckons one new Chinese platform. That’s how much a track costs at Wawawa, a new offering started by ringtone firm R2G with repertoire from San Fran-based indie…
